Paramount appears to learn from its 'Big Brother' racial double standard on 'The Challenge'

Three contestants were removed from MTV's "The Challenge: Cutthroat" after a reported racial incident involving the N-word and a code of conduct breach.

Paramount's decision follows increased scrutiny over how the company has handled racial incidents on its reality television shows, particularly following criticism of its handling of similar situations on "Big Brother."
